What should I do if the leaves of the Smooth Sailing flower become soft?

In the process of flower care, drooping or limp leaves are common problems that flower lovers sometimes encounter, such as when caring for the plant Lucky Leaf . Faced with this situation, many flower lovers may feel confused and don’t know how to deal with it. Let’s learn together what to do when the leaves of the Smooth Sailing flower become soft?

1. Lighting management

Strong direct sunlight, especially during high temperatures in summer and early fall, can cause the leaves and flower buds of the plant to wilt. Although this plant is shade tolerant, it also requires moderate light. Generally speaking, 60% of the light conditions are sufficient to meet its growth needs. At the same time, avoid placing it in an environment without sunlight for a long time to avoid affecting flowering.

2. Water supply

During the growing season, if it is not watered for a long time or the air is too dry, the leaves and flowers of the plant may wilt due to lack of water. Water regularly, at least every two or three days, to keep the soil slightly moist. If the soil remains moist, it may cause root rot, so wait until the soil in the pot is slightly dry before watering, and maintain good ventilation.

3. Soil selection

Use peat soil or leaf mold, and add river sand or perlite to improve the looseness and drainage of the soil, and at the same time add an appropriate amount of decomposed cake fertilizer as base fertilizer. Replacing the potting soil and pruning the roots before germination each spring will help promote healthy growth.

4. Temperature and fertilization

The temperature should be kept above 10 degrees in winter to avoid hypothermia damage. During the growing season, apply diluted compound fertilizer or organic fertilizer water every two weeks to support normal growth and flowering.

By following the simple care tips above, you can ensure that the leaves of the smooth sailing plant remain green and the flowers continue to bloom. If you notice that the leaves are wilting, you can quickly help the plant recover by adjusting the light, water and soil conditions.
